Rb20det revs fine, all the way up to the limiter, but when in gear, it will stall

It will drive fine for about 5 seconds, (enough to get out of the drive way) then it stalls.. Any ideas? This was a rb20det I swapped into an s13.. It builds boost and all while sittig in neutral, or with the clutch in.. But as soon as torque is applied, it stalls.

If it revs fine in neutral, why would you even try to rev it in gear with the clutch pressed in? Just trying to figure out your reasoning to see if we should even proceed...

Torque = load
The ecu computes timing, injector pulse, injector pulse length etc. depending on the load.
Ecu uses the following sensors to determine load:
-MAF
-TPS
-oxygen sensor
-coolant temp sensor(maybe not)
-knock sensor(maybe not)
- x-sensor where x is any other sensor I missed

Now, what do you think happens when one of those sensors is not functioning correctly?
